Project description

Pavment is beyond its servicable life and is showing significant signs of distress and failure with - deep rutting evident for 70% of the Road - cracking in the seal for 25% of the Road; and - shoving along the outside wheel path for 5% of the Road Roadside drainage needs to be re-established to maintain the integrity of the road pavement

Rehabilitate full width of road pavement - import new pavement material to create cross fall - stabilise the existing pavement by the addition of cementicious product - reseal pavement. Reshape roadside drainage to ensure adequate depth to drain the pavement and drains flow to existing culverts
